logo

Output 31b25089d74859e68c991d60fcb9ab48d5d80cdff98a7ea7c6d122b13115144d:0

value
710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61e3bb3fe948cca660a50945c0ce0308b475341 OP_EQUAL
address
3KkZwAdN9D8ATrLirwAirUrn1LKC8dCvbu
transaction
31b25089d74859e68c991d60fcb9ab48d5d80cdff98a7ea7c6d122b13115144d